Nestled in the heart of picturesque Switzerland, the small town of Meiringen is a study in rich history and scenic beauty. Famous for the impressive Reichenbach Falls, a historical landmark linked to Sir Arthur Conan Doyle's Sherlock Holmes stories, the town is an anthology of Swiss heritage. Geographically, Meiringen is beautifully set in the Hasli valley, surrounded by majestic alpine scenery. Meiringen can be conveniently reached by road and rail, while the nearest major city, Bern, is just over an hour away. The Belp Airport in Bern offers convenient international connections.

Culture and Infrastructure
The cultural scene in Meiringen is vibrant, with the annual Meiringen Hasliberg Snowsports event being a renowned attraction. Art lovers would enjoy visiting the Sherlock Holmes Museum, and the Ballenberg Open-Air Museum in the vicinity.
In terms of public infrastructure, Meiringen is well equipped. The Oberhasli Hospital serves the healthcare needs of the community, while the education sector boasts of quality schools and the nearby University of Bern.
